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09381 33 522
2858660203 89
2858660203 89
66234934 1080973 61
All about undefined
Interested in learning more?
2858660203 89
66234934 1080973 61
See more
5530249 507431925
151908696 11605620065 627290404 92955309
See more
5623880 81 66382509083
187 291521 4319
See more